Searched defs:map_info_list (Results 1 - 6 of 6) sorted by relevance

/system/core/libcorkscrew/
H A Dptrace.c38 void init_memory(memory_t* memory, const map_info_t* map_info_list) { argument
40 memory->map_info_list = map_info_list;
45 memory->map_info_list = NULL;
56 if (!is_readable_map(memory->map_info_list, ptr)) {
105 context->map_info_list = load_map_info_list(pid);
106 for (map_info_t* mi = context->map_info_list; mi; mi = mi->next) {
128 for (map_info_t* mi = context->map_info_list; mi; mi = mi->next) {
131 free_map_info_list(context->map_info_list);
137 const map_info_t* mi = find_map_info(context->map_info_list, add
[all...]
H A Dbacktrace.c118 const map_info_t* map_info_list; member in struct:__anon393
129 g_unwind_signal_state.map_info_list,
162 g_unwind_signal_state.map_info_list = milist;
/system/core/include/corkscrew/
H A Dptrace.h36 map_info_t* map_info_list; member in struct:__anon297
42 const map_info_t* map_info_list; member in struct:__anon298
84 void init_memory(memory_t* memory, const map_info_t* map_info_list);
/system/core/libcorkscrew/arch-mips/
H A Dbacktrace-mips.c73 const map_info_t* map_info_list,
157 const map_info_t* map_info_list,
171 init_memory(&memory, map_info_list);
172 return unwind_backtrace_common(&memory, map_info_list,
195 return unwind_backtrace_common(&memory, context->map_info_list,
72 unwind_backtrace_common(const memory_t* memory, const map_info_t* map_info_list, unwind_state_t* state, backtrace_frame_t* backtrace, size_t ignore_depth, size_t max_depth) argument
156 unwind_backtrace_signal_arch(siginfo_t* siginfo, void* sigcontext, const map_info_t* map_info_list, backtrace_frame_t* backtrace, size_t ignore_depth, size_t max_depth) argument
/system/core/libcorkscrew/arch-arm/
H A Dbacktrace-arm.c122 const map_info_t* map_info_list, uintptr_t pc) {
135 mi = find_map_info(map_info_list, pc);
487 const map_info_t* map_info_list,
502 uintptr_t handler = get_exception_handler(memory, map_info_list, pc);
546 && is_executable_map(map_info_list, state->gregs[R_LR])) {
556 const map_info_t* map_info_list,
580 init_memory(&memory, map_info_list);
581 return unwind_backtrace_common(&memory, map_info_list, &state,
599 return unwind_backtrace_common(&memory, context->map_info_list, &state,
121 get_exception_handler(const memory_t* memory, const map_info_t* map_info_list, uintptr_t pc) argument
486 unwind_backtrace_common(const memory_t* memory, const map_info_t* map_info_list, unwind_state_t* state, backtrace_frame_t* backtrace, size_t ignore_depth, size_t max_depth) argument
555 unwind_backtrace_signal_arch(siginfo_t* siginfo, void* sigcontext, const map_info_t* map_info_list, backtrace_frame_t* backtrace, size_t ignore_depth, size_t max_depth) argument
/system/core/libcorkscrew/arch-x86/
H A Dbacktrace-x86.c238 const map_info_t* map_info_list, uintptr_t pc) {
243 const map_info_t* mi = find_map_info(map_info_list, pc);
548 const map_info_t* map_info_list,
755 const map_info_t* map_info_list,
768 uintptr_t fde = find_fde(memory, map_info_list, state->reg[DWARF_EIP]);
803 if (!execute_fde(memory, map_info_list, fde, state)) break;
817 const map_info_t* map_info_list,
827 init_memory(&memory, map_info_list);
828 return unwind_backtrace_common(&memory, map_info_list,
846 return unwind_backtrace_common(&memory, context->map_info_list,
237 find_fde(const memory_t* memory, const map_info_t* map_info_list, uintptr_t pc) argument
547 execute_fde(const memory_t* memory, const map_info_t* map_info_list, uintptr_t fde, unwind_state_t* state) argument
754 unwind_backtrace_common(const memory_t* memory, const map_info_t* map_info_list, unwind_state_t* state, backtrace_frame_t* backtrace, size_t ignore_depth, size_t max_depth) argument
816 unwind_backtrace_signal_arch(siginfo_t* siginfo __attribute__((unused)), void* sigcontext, const map_info_t* map_info_list, backtrace_frame_t* backtrace, size_t ignore_depth, size_t max_depth) argument
[all...]

Completed in 62 milliseconds